What is CVE-2026-16616?

The Simple File List WordPress plugin through version 6.3.11 is vulnerable due to its failure to validate the source path during file-move operations. This issue allows unauthenticated users to access arbitrary files on the server. Moreover, it enables them to move critical files out of the web root, raising significant security concerns related to sensitive information disclosure and potential site takeover.

Affected Version(s)

Simple File List 0 <= 6.3.11
